Caramel Coloring Ingredients - Caramel color (e150a, e150b, e150c, e150d) is a water soluble dark brown liquid or solid that is used as a coloring agent. Caramel coloring (also referred to as caramel color) is an edible brown food additive made by heating a variety of carbohydrates, such as corn, high fructose corn syrup, various types of sugar, or malt syrup.
